Output 51f3613fb4a75be06bd9f16d3d0d7ac8b9343cbdaca8e1c0d71545972c405e11:4

value
132784
script pubkey
OP_0 OP_PUSHBYTES_20 26d0433f8b70767ee70e23320625f246f6f1ca29
address
bc1qymgyx0utwpm8aecwyveqvf0jgmm0rj3ft5teyw
transaction
51f3613fb4a75be06bd9f16d3d0d7ac8b9343cbdaca8e1c0d71545972c405e11
confirmations
20644
spent
true